Spies, russians and maximalists in the summer of 1919. The Tragic Week revisited from the diplomatic and journalistic sources
Published 2020“…The aim of this paper is to revisit the Tragic Week of 1919 in Buenos Aires, analyzing new sources that belong from the foreign diplomacy and the espionage. In addition, it examines the mainstreamperspectives and bibliography.The little-explored documents enables new questions on an apparently already-known subject, with respect to which, however, recent works have shown that there are still different aspects to deepen.…”

The Great Fear of 1919 on a Global Scale: Argentina's Tragic Week and the North American Archives
Published 2020“…In this article we inscribe the events of the Tragic Week of 1919 in a transnational perspective, considering the ways in which U.S. diplomacy and intelligence services analyzed and interpreted it and linked it to a set of contemporary events and processes. …”

Global governance in the health sector: changes in the “world order”, in the international arena and impacts in health
Published 2020“…This paper examines global governance in the health sector, drawing on discussions of the context in which this term emerged along with other related denominations such as global health, global health governance (or global governance for health), and health diplomacy (or global health diplomacy). It is framed by policy analysis theory, on the assumption that both domestic policies —including foreign policy— and international policies are considered public policies, given that they interrelate different actors, ideas and preferences at the various different stages in the decision-making process: agenda-setting, policymaking, implementation and outcomes. …”
